The Art of Bespoke Gifting and Its Rising Popularity

The concept of bespoke gifting, essentially commissioning unique, custom-made items, isn’t entirely new. Historically, affluent individuals have always relied on artisans to create pieces tailored to their exact specifications. However, the democratization of online marketplaces and the rise of independent creators have made bespoke gifting accessible to a much wider audience. This has spurred significant growth in industries catering to personalization, including handcrafted goods, custom design services, and personalized printing. People increasingly value the story behind a product, and knowing that an item was made specifically for them adds an emotional resonance that mass-produced alternatives simply cannot replicate. The ability to collaborate directly with the artisan, refining details and influencing the creative process, further enhances this sense of ownership and connection. This has transformed gifting from a transactional exchange to a meaningful experience.

Gift Type Personalization Options Typical Price Range Suitable Occasions
Custom Portrait Style, size, subject, background £75 – £500+ Birthdays, anniversaries, memorials
Engraved Jewelry Names, dates, quotes, symbols £30 – £300+ Weddings, graduations, milestones
Personalized Photo Album Photos, captions, cover design £25 – £150+ Anniversaries, birthdays, baby showers
Handmade Ceramics Colors, patterns, size, custom shapes £20 – £200+ Housewarming, birthdays, thank you gifts

The table above offers a small glimpse into the diverse range of bespoke gifting options available, along with typical price ranges and appropriate occasions. It is important to note that pricing can vary greatly depending on the complexity of the customization, the materials used, and the artist’s expertise.

Choosing the Right Personalized Gift: Considering the Recipient

Selecting a truly meaningful personalized gift requires careful consideration of the recipient’s personality, interests, and preferences. A generic, albeit expensive, item simply won't have the same impact as something tailored specifically to their passions. Understanding their hobbies, favorite colors, and personal style is crucial. For example, a book lover might appreciate a first edition of their favorite author, custom bookends, or a personalized bookmark. A music enthusiast could be delighted with a custom guitar pick, a framed concert poster, or a vinyl record with a personalized label. Going beyond material possessions, consider experiences – a cooking class focused on their favorite cuisine, a weekend getaway to a destination they've always dreamed of visiting, or tickets to a concert featuring their favorite artist. The key is to show that you've taken the time to understand what truly makes them happy.

Understanding Turnaround Times and Shipping Considerations

Personalized gifts often require a longer production time than mass-produced items, as they are made to order. Be sure to inquire about the artisan’s turnaround time before placing your order, especially if you have a specific deadline. Factor in shipping time as well, particularly if you are ordering from an international seller. Communicate your timeline clearly to the artisan and ask about expedited shipping options if necessary. It’s also important to consider packaging – a well-presented gift adds to the overall experience. Ask the artisan about their packaging practices and whether they offer gift wrapping services. Paying close attention to these details ensures a smooth and enjoyable gifting experience for both you and the recipient.
